Kinds Of Pram Pushchairs
Before diving into choice criteria, it's important to familiarize yourself with the various kinds of pram pushchairs readily available. The following table sums up the primary types and their essential functions:
TypeDescriptionProsConsTraditional PramStandard style with a big bassinet and tough frame.Elegant look, comfy for newborns.Can be large and heavy.Travel SystemConsists of a suitable automobile seat that connects to the pram frame.Practical for parents on-the-go.Limited usage as the kid grows.Lightweight/CompactCreated for easy maneuverability and storage; typically retractable.Perfect for city living and public transport.May lack sturdiness and functions.All-TerrainBuilt for rugged surface areas; bigger wheels and suspension.Great for adventurous households.Heavier and tough to steer in tight spaces.Double PramAccommodates 2 kids, usually with side-by-side or tandem seating setups.Ideal for twins or siblings of different ages.Much heavier and may use up more area.Key Features to Consider
When selecting a pram pushchair, there are several functions to bear in mind. Below is a checklist of important elements to consider:
Safety: Ensure that the pram abides by safety requirements, has a five-point harness, and includes a trustworthy braking system.Weight and Maneuverability: A lightweight pram is often simpler to deal with, particularly when navigating through crowded areas.Foldability: Look for a model that folds quickly and compactly for storage and transportation.Comfort: Ensure the pram has good suspension, cushioned seating, and appropriate canopy protection for sun protection.Storage: Check for an adequate under-seat storage basket to accommodate diaper bags, groceries, or other essentials.Adjustable Features: Consider prams that have adjustable deals with, reclining seats, and removable canopies for added adaptability.Sturdiness: Look for high-quality materials that can stand up to regular usage over a number of years.The Buying Process

To guarantee your pram stays in good condition, regular maintenance is crucial. Here are some pointers on how to care for your pram:
Cleaning: Wipe down the frame and materials regularly, and follow the producer's instructions for deep cleaning.Lubrication: Keep wheels and moving parts well-lubricated to make sure smooth operation.Check for Wear and Tear: Regularly inspect straps, wheels, and joints for any indications of damage.Shop Properly: When not in use, save the pram in a dry location to prevent mold and rust.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
